Product information "Epiphone 1957 SJ-200 Antique Natural"
The world‑famous SJ‑200 is known as the King of the Flat‑Tops, and it was the choice of countless legends — from singing cowboys to country, folk and rock icons, up to some of today's most popular artists. Now Epiphone is proud to release the 1957 SJ‑200 in collaboration with the Gibson Custom Shop. This impressive guitar features a thermally aged solid Sitka spruce top supported by scalloped X‑bracing, solid figured maple back and sides, and a neck of flamed maple with a C profile, laurel fretboard and graduated crown pearl inlays. The headstock has the Gibson "Open‑book" shape, together with a mother‑of‑pearl crown and Epiphone logo inlays, and the Inspired by Gibson Custom double diamond logo is etched on the back. The iconic J‑200 moustache‑style bridge and engraved pickguard are present, as are a compensated bone bridge, a bone nut and bone bridge pins. It's even fitted with an L.R.Baggs™ VTC preamp and an undersaddle pickup, so it's ready to go on stage or in the studio as soon as you take it out of the included Inspired by Gibson Custom hardshell case.

When you think of Epiphone you naturally think of Gibson, since the maker of guitars, basses, amplifiers and accessories has been part of that company since 1957. Epiphone mainly offers instruments in the lower to mid price range. That means beginners can pick up electric guitar and bass classics such as Les Paul, SG, Explorer, Firebird, ES-335 or Thunderbird for little money. There are also instruments from earlier Epiphone eras like Casino, Wildkat, Riviera and Wilshire.
